JavaScript is not enabled.
I'm a fan of Superior Care Auto Center - Review by citysearch c | Superior Care Auto Center

Superior Care Auto Center

Claim

I'm a fan of Superior Care Auto Center 7/3/2012

.... they keep our old Subaru going at 1/3rd the price estimate of the official S. dealer more
Summer SALE!!!:
15% OFF all yearly plans
Use year15 at checkout. Expires 1/1/2021